INFORMATION SECURITY ANALYSIS OF E-GOVERNMENT USING COBIT5 FRAMEWORK Novianto, Fanny

Untuk dapat dinilai pada level berikutnya proses tersebut harus mencapai kategori Fully achieved (F).   Kata kunci: keamanan informasi, e-government, COBIT5 ------------------- The government is currently implementing the e-government (e-gov) system in Indonesia. E-gov is a government system based on information technology. In principle, this e-gov innovation is to improve the quality of the service process from government agencies to the public through online public services. In the implementation of e-gov, information security is the most important thing in the use of applied information technology. Government information and data security, especially information that can be accessed and displayed through a web application, is prone to being hacked. The Correctional Division of the Regional Office of the Ministry of Law and Human Rights of the Special Region of Yogyakarta is currently implementing e-gov in internal business processes and public services in line with Sistem Informasi Pemasyarakatan Yogyakarta (Sipasta). Some data and information in private sector are limited in terms of access and confidentiality. Private users are the public and the Aparatur Sipil Negara (ASN) Regional Office of the Ministry of Law and Human Rights of the Special Region of Yogyakarta. This has an impact on the number of exchanges of information where the information is important, confidential and has limited access rights that are only intended for certain users. The research method used is the COBIT5 framework with a focus on the APO13 and DSS05 domains. The results of the Process Capability Model analysis are at level 2 or managed process. This is because the rating achievements in the performance management and work product management domains of APO13 and DSS05 are Largely Achieved. To be assessed at the next level the process must reach the Fully achieved (F) category Keywords: information security, e-government, COBIT5
Evaluation of E-Government Using COBIT 5 Framework (Case Study of Sistem Database Pemasyarakatan Implementation in Ministry of Law and Human Rights in the Special Region of Yogyakarta) Novianto, Fanny; Siregar, Maria Ulfah

Information technology has become an important element in the industrial era 4.0, an era where the concept of automation is known in the production process carried out by technology by reducing the role of humans in its application. Since the issuance of Presidential Instruction Number 3/2003 concerning National Policies and Strategies for E-Government Development, both central government and local governments, have begun to move to develop e-government in their respective regions. The Ministry of Law and Human Rights of the Republic of Indonesia is currently implementing e-government in internal business processes and public services that aimed at serving prime communities, eliminating illegal payments, and creating transparent and accountable performance. One of them is the use of the Sistem Database Pemasyarakatan (SDP). Data and information in the SDP are confidential because one of them contains data and information on criminals in Indonesia. The research method used is a quantitative method using a questionnaire instrument and using the 5th edition of the COBIT framework model and emphasizes on information security. From the gap analysis, it can be recommended one of them is Organizations must integrate security into every facet of management and operations. This begins with identifying all business processes and associated stakeholders, including audit.
